The primary advantage is its near-invisibility underwater, which can significantly increase your catch rate by reducing the fish's ability to detect the line.
While designed for freshwater, it can be used in light saltwater conditions. However, for consistent saltwater use, dedicated saltwater fluorocarbon lines with enhanced corrosion resistance are generally recommended.
Red Label offers a balance of performance and value, focusing on core fluorocarbon strengths like invisibility and durability. Other Seaguar lines may offer specialized features like enhanced sensitivity, increased suppleness, or superior UV resistance.
The 17lb test is a strong, versatile option for freshwater applications, particularly for bass fishing. It provides good strength for fighting fish and handling moderate cover while maintaining the benefits of fluorocarbon.
While primarily recommended for baitcasting reels due to its stiffness, some anglers may use it on spinning reels. However, it may exhibit more memory and be more prone to wind knots than lines specifically designed for spinning reels.
Inspect the line regularly for damage. Store it properly away from UV light and heat. Replace the line periodically, especially after heavy use or encounters with abrasive environments.
While designed to be nearly invisible, in certain lighting or water conditions, some visibility may occur. Try using a leader of a different material or a slightly thinner diameter if fish remain spooked.
Ensure you are using knots specifically recommended for fluorocarbon lines and that you moisten the knot before tightening. Over-tightening a dry knot can weaken it.
Fluorocarbon can have more memory than monofilament. Stretching the line gently after spooling or using a line conditioner can help reduce stiffness. Allow the line to warm up to ambient temperature before use.
Inspect the line for nicks or abrasions, especially after encountering structure. Ensure knots are tied correctly and have sufficient strength for the target species and fishing conditions.
Setup: Seaguar Red Label Fluorocarbon is designed for use on baitcasting reels. Ensure your reel is properly spooled, avoiding overfilling to prevent backlash. Tie your knots securely, utilizing knots recommended for fluorocarbon lines (e.g., the Palomar knot or improved clinch knot) to maximize strength. Consider using a leader of a different material if specific line properties are needed for your technique.
Compatibility: This line is ideal as a main line for most freshwater baitcasting applications. It performs well with a variety of lures and rigs commonly used in bass, walleye, and panfish fishing.
Care: Store the line in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ight to preserve its integrity. After fishing, especially in saltwater or abrasive environments, rinse the line with fresh water. Periodically inspect the line for nicks or abrasions, particularly after fighting fish or encountering underwater obstacles, and trim or replace as needed.
